Latest Patents

Arve Sund holds a patent for an aluminum strip designed specifically for lithographic printing plate supports. This invention focuses on producing printing plate supports with improved roughenability and enhanced mechanical properties, especially after a burn-in process. The aluminum alloy used in this strip consists of specific proportions of alloy constituents, including magnesium, manganese, iron, silicon, copper, titanium, and aluminum, ensuring optimal performance in printing applications.
